Hi everone, I think this issue has be discussed before, but i think my case is a bit different (if its not i am sorry but im a newbie to this as of now) here is my issue.

I have always written DVD CD's on Maxell DVD-R CD's (Up to 8X) Always on the lowest speed because i dident want anything to go wrong (I guess im the slow and stedy type of person)

Any way.. the issue is i ran out of CD's and went to get more, i noticed that there were no Maxell DVD-R 8x CD's but there were Maxell DVD-R 16x CD's so i bought a 25 pack.... thinking it cant be that big of a difference but well.... then "Illegal Error"

I use Nero Burning Rom v6.6.0.1, and i tried burning on every different speed that was offered with the 16x CD and in simulation mode always the same thing, one thing i did notice though with my 8x maxell CD's im not "allowed" to change the speed the tab becomes gray but with the 16x i can change speeds... any way heres the log please help.
